摘要

PROBLEM TO BE SOLVED: To provide a flexure plate and a flexure absorption structure, a coupling of a metal disk using the flexure plate, and a mechanical device provided with the same. It is already well known to use a 6-bolt flexible plate having a large arm length L of the flexible plate in a reversing hub structure (diametrically combined flexible plate flange method), but an adapter hub structure ( The combined use in the circumferential direction combined flexible plate flange system) has been avoided as technical insane. This review confirms that it is not unreasonable to use a 6-bolt flexible plate in the adapter hub structure (flexible plate flange method combined in the circumferential direction). Suitable for applications such as power generation. [Selection] Figure 1
